House Oversight Subpoenas Biden Aides Over Presidential Competence Concerns

The House Oversight Committee, led by Chairman Rep. James Comer (R-KY), has issued subpoenas to three senior staffers of President Joe Biden. This action aims to investigate allegations that President Biden is not personally executing the duties of his office and is overly reliant on his aides. The subpoenas target Ashley Williams, Special Assistant to the President and Deputy Director of Oval Office Operations; Annie Tomasini, Deputy Chief of Staff; and Anthony Bernal, Assistant to the President and Senior Advisor to the First Lady.

Chairman Comer has raised concerns about the extent of President Biden’s involvement in presidential responsibilities. The investigation seeks to determine whether Biden is capable of fulfilling his duties independently or if he is overly dependent on his aides, effectively operating within a “protective bubble” that shields him from independent decision-making. Comer stated, “We need to know if the President is the one making decisions or if his staff is running the show behind the scenes.”

This inquiry comes amid growing skepticism about President Biden’s capacity to perform his role without significant assistance. Critics argue that his age and perceived cognitive decline may impair his ability to govern effectively. These concerns have intensified following several high-profile gaffes and public appearances where Biden appeared confused or disoriented.

The subpoenas demand that Williams, Tomasini, and Bernal provide depositions to clarify the degree to which they are involved in presidential decision-making. Comer emphasized that the committee aims to uncover whether the President is merely a figurehead with his aides exercising substantial control over the executive branch. “The American people deserve transparency regarding the President’s ability to fulfill his constitutional responsibilities,” Comer asserted.

Ashley Williams, in her role as Special Assistant to the President, has significant influence over the daily operations of the Oval Office. Her testimony is expected to shed light on the extent of her involvement in managing presidential tasks. Similarly, Annie Tomasini, as Deputy Chief of Staff, holds a critical position in overseeing the President’s schedule and interactions. Anthony Bernal’s role as a Senior Advisor to the First Lady also positions him close to the President, making his deposition crucial for understanding the dynamics within the White House.

“Subsequent to the President’s ‘disastrous’ debate performance in June, officials in the House of Representatives, the Senate, and the White House have voiced concerns about the President’s ability to lead the country. Recent reporting has revealed a White House in disarray, and one former Biden aide has said that ‘Annie [Tomasini], Ashley [Williams] and Anthony [Bernal] create a protective bubble around’ President Biden, and the President is ‘staffed so closely that he’s lost all independence,'” the letter read.
